Aspose.Cells操作指南:上传与导出

5星 · 超过95%的资源 需积分: 13 13 下载量 98 浏览量 更新于2024-07-23 收藏 1.11MB PDF 举报
"Aspose.Cells是用于处理Microsoft Excel文件的强大的编程库,它允许开发者在不依赖Office的情况下进行创建、读取、修改和转换Excel文件。此操作说明主要涵盖了上传和导出的工作流程,以及一些核心功能的使用,包括对Workbook对象的详细操作。" 在Aspose.Cells中,Workbook对象是整个Excel文件的核心,它包含了所有的数据、样式和工作表。以下是一些重要的 Workbook 属性及其功能: 1. **Colors**: 这是一个Color数组,用于获取或设置Excel文件中的颜色信息。你可以通过这个属性来管理自定义的颜色或者更改默认颜色。 2. **ConvertNumericData**: 这是一个布尔值,表示是否在读取数据时自动将字符串转换为数字。默认值为true,意味着Aspose.Cells会尝试将文本数据解析为数值。 3. **DataSorter**: 提供了数据排序的功能,可以设置条件对工作簿中的数据进行排序。 4. **Date1904**: 布尔值,表示日期系统是否基于1904年1月1日,这是Excel的一种日期系统选项。 5. **DefaultStyle**: 这是工作簿的默认样式,用于设置新创建单元格的样式。 6. **HasMacro**: 检查工作簿是否包含宏或宏命令。 7. **IsHScrollBarVisible** 和 **IsVScrollBarVisible**: 分别控制工作簿视图中的水平和垂直滚动条的可见性。 8. **IsProtected**: 判断工作簿是否被保护,如果设置为true,用户将无法进行某些编辑操作。 9. **Password**: 设置或获取工作簿的密码,用于加密和解密。 10. **ReCalcOnOpen**: 如果设置为true,Aspose.Cells会在打开工作簿时重新计算所有公式。 11. **Region** 和 **Language**: 分别设置工作簿的语言和区域设置,影响日期、货币等格式。 12. **Shared**: 表示工作簿是否为共享文件,影响多人协作的情况。 13. **ShowTabs**: 控制是否显示工作表标签,默认情况下是可见的。 14. **Styles**: 一个样式集合,包含所有可用的单元格样式,可以用于应用到工作簿的各个部分。 15. **Worksheets**: 包含Workbook中的所有工作表,可以添加、删除或访问这些工作表。 此外,Workbook还支持一些关键事件,如CalculateFormula,用于在计算公式时触发自定义逻辑,以及ChangePalette、Combine、Copy、Decrypt等方法,用于改变调色板、合并工作簿、复制工作簿和解密工作簿。 Aspose.Cells提供了一个全面的API,使得开发者能够灵活地处理Excel文件,无论是创建新的工作簿、导入导出数据、应用样式还是执行复杂的公式计算,都能轻松应对。